
Technical and Tactical Characteristics of the RDG-2B Grenade
- Type
- Smoke
- Weight
- 420-550 g
- Diameter
- 53 mm
- Length
- 209-221 mm
- Smoke emission time
- 60-90 sec
- Initiation method
- Match / friction
- Smoke color
- White
- Body wall thickness
- 2 mm
- Quantity per crate
- 60 pcs
The RDG-2B is ignited by an integral match igniter. To employ the grenade, the side caps must be removed using the tapes, and the striker must be rubbed against the igniter head to ignite it. The igniter may also be lit with ordinary matches or a lighter. After this, the grenade can be thrown. It is strictly not recommended to hold the grenade in the hand or approach closer than 0.5 m while it is burning, as this may cause burns.

Under average meteorological conditions, one RDG-2B grenade creates an opaque cloud of white smoke 20-25 meters long.
Composition of the chemical mixture:
- potassium chlorate (45%), Berthollet's salt
- ammonium chloride (43%) — this is what gives the smoke its white color
- anthracene (12%)


RDG-2B grenades are stored in crates of 60 units. Crate weight is 34 kg.
